基于边缘方向的直线提取算法 被引量:10

Line Extraction Based on Edge Direction

摘要 研究一种快速的图像直线提取算法.将边缘按方向划分成若干子边缘,利用判据从子边缘提取出局部直线,然后依据准则合并相应子边缘直线得到全局直线及参数.准确提取出图像中的直线特征及端点和方向等参数.仿真实验结果表明,该算法比Hough变换能更准确、快速、可靠地提取图像的直线特征. Investigates a fast algorithm of line feature extraction. Divides the edge into several sub-edges in one direction and detect lines from sub-edges according to the line extraction criterions. Then merges the lines that conform to the incorporation criterion. The line features and their parameters are accurately obtained. Simulation results indicate that the proposed algorithm is more precise, speedier and reliable in line extraction than with the Hough transform.
